Scott Margolies, M.D., assistant professor in the Department of Anesthesiology and Perioperative Medicine, has enthusiastically accepted the position of Anesthesia Medical Director at UAB West, effective February 1, 2021.

Dr. Margolies obtained his Doctor of Medicine degree from the University of Alabama School of Medicine in 2000, followed by a residency in anesthesiology in our department between 2000 and 2004. After completing his residency, he stayed on as a faculty member, and served as an assistant medical director at the TKC Preoperative Assessment Clinic. In 2005, Dr. Margolies joined Southern Perioperative Services (SPS), a well-established and highly regarded private practice in the Birmingham area. SPS has strong ties to UAB Anesthesiology and Perioperative Medicine, and both our professional and business relationships are outstanding. In light of the strong business relationship between SPS and our department, during 2009 to 2010, Dr. Margolies returned to UAB (in conjunction with SPS) to help our department’s rapid growth in the cardiac arena at the time. During his tenure with SPS, Dr. Margolies spent significant time at UAB West because the service contract was jointly managed by our department and SPS. Over the years, Dr. Margolies has established a solid collegial working relationship with UAB West surgeons, CRNAs, perioperative nursing, and hospital leadership. He has been instrumental during our service transition at UAB West over the last six months, and undoubtedly will provide strong leadership at UAB West for many years to come.
